Read all the positive reviews and was excited to try the place out, so I headed over after work recently and ordered through the drive-thru. I ordered 2 1/4 cheeseburgers with everything on it and fries. Guy on the intercom kinda rushed me through the order and so was not given a chance to ask if I could get the burgers done medium-rare. I was in line for a while, as there was another customer in front of me, but I was ok with it since the food was all being made fresh and figured a wait is inevitable. Paid and got my food, took it home, and started eating, and was actually disappointed with how it turned out. The grilled onions tasted pretty burnt, and the bread-to-burger ratio was something else. Like, after I removed the burnt onions and continued to eat, all I tasted was bread. Each bite was a very subtle hint of beef drowned out by the overwhelming taste of bread and burnt onion residue. I had to re-open the burger to confirm that there was an actual beef patty in there. Fries were ok, at least.

I always drive by Franksville, last night I decided to try it. The place looks a little old from the outside. It has a nice size parking lot, and a drive through if you don’t want to get off your car. Inside looks newly remodeled. The restaurant was clean. The floors and tables were clean. The staff greeted me with a smile and were very friendly. The food was good. My burger was great, the presentation could use work. I haven’t had good onion rings in a while, they were great. The fries however were a little plain. My kids liked the chili dogs and the burgers. My wife had the Italian beef and she didn’t complain, she’s a picky eater. Overall my experience was great at Franksville.
